Below is a look at the 00Z model set on Hurricane Irene… And, the intensity forecast…. Looks like Irene will pass near, or just east of the North Carolina Outer Banks Saturday night, perhaps as a category three hurricane. Irene is now expected to become a major hurricane, with landfall on the South Carolina coast Saturday morning. Again, no impact on Alabama or the Gulf Coast. This will be the first hurricane landfall on the U.S. coast since Ike in 2008.
